Handover: BranchReaper bot. It scans repos nightly, flags branches idle >90 days, deletes after two warnings. Config lives in `reaper.yaml`; don't touch the exclusion list without checking with platform team. Known issue: it double-notifies on forked repos — workaround documented in the wiki. Deploys via the standard pipeline, no manual steps. Dry-run mode exists; use it. Logs go to the ops dashboard. For anything unclear, ask the owner listed here.

account owner for bawip-tahag: Raleth Quenok

Ticket: Staging env misconfigured for Siftgate bloom filter

The bloom layer in front of the Pellet KV store is rejecting all lookups in staging because the env file was copied from the dev template without credentials. False-positive tuning values are fine; only the auth line is missing. To unblock the weekly demo, the Pellet admission secret must be set on the following line.

env line for yaguf-fajop: LEDGER_TOKEN13=fb08984397349

Handover Note — Director Transition, Corbin to Amaya

Amaya, the Lanternfield launch is staged for the first week of next quarter. Finance holds the approved budget; media spend releases in two tranches pending the readiness review. Pricing was locked with the Westrow distributors last month, and inventory builds at the Caldmere site are on schedule. Flag any variance over five percent immediately. The confidential plan summary follows below.

internal memo for fahaf-yajog: Jorirox Partners is in early talks to buy Belaxek Systems for about $407.6 million. The Fraius launch date is October 14, and nothing goes to the press before then. Legal wants the Gilionek Partners term sheet withdrawn before February 11.

## Authentication

Heads up: the nightly reindex job (`reindex_nightly.py`) talks to the Lanternfish search cluster, and that cluster won't accept anonymous writes anymore — we locked it down last sprint. The job now authenticates as the `reindex-runner` service identity against Corvid Gateway, and the token is injected via the `LF_INDEX_TOKEN` env var in the scheduler config. Nothing clever going on, just a bearer header on every batch request. For review purposes, the staging credential currently in use is listed below.

service key, kadug-kadup: kto15_rN23XLAYImmZgrJ